Output e98aa77bccf9e3b7e80eab2f1baeaae7208cc6e5426c10ec544879be77913d88:1

value
6978022927802
script pubkey
OP_0 OP_PUSHBYTES_20 c28b1d39e3cd3344d4bdb1fb1ac0321977851041
address
tb1qc2936w0re5e5f49ak8a34spjr9mc2yzpkm76j9
transaction
e98aa77bccf9e3b7e80eab2f1baeaae7208cc6e5426c10ec544879be77913d88
confirmations
173189
spent
true